思路很简单,我们用鼠标点击选中导航栏XAF做了什么事,在代码中把这些事做掉就行。XAF中处理导航栏响应的ViewController 是ShowNavigationItemController,该ViewController中的ShowNavigationItemAction是个SingleChoiceAction,它下面包含了许多ChoiceActionItem,这些ChoiceActionItem就是我们导航栏全部的项目。所以,只要获取了ShowNavigationItemController的ShowNavigationItemAction,就可以在代码中选中某导航项目了。

I I
<
XAF代码中选中导航栏子项方法

本文介绍了如何在XAF框架中通过代码实现导航栏子项的选中。关键在于利用ShowNavigationItemController及其内的ShowNavigationItemAction和ChoiceActionItem,通过编程方式模拟鼠标点击选中特定导航项。
最低0.47元/天 解锁文章
2266

被折叠的 条评论
为什么被折叠?



